    Cover Letter Trends: How To Write A Cover Letter In 2025

    When it comes to applying for jobs, cover letters have long been a staple of the process. But let’s face it: traditional cover letters are a thing of the past. If you’re still using a “To Whom It May Concern” template to summarize your resume, stop. The traditional cover letter is dead, and it’s time to embrace a new approach—one that truly connects with potential employers.


    Welcome to the era of disruptive cover letters.

    Why Traditional Cover Letters Don’t Work

    The old-school cover letter, often just a regurgitation of your resume, rarely gets read. Why? Many hiring managers now assume these cover letters are auto-generated by AI tools like ChatGPT, making them impersonal and uninspiring. Employers want authenticity, and a generic summary doesn’t deliver.

    Instead of rehashing your qualifications, your cover letter should tell a story—one that resonates with the employer and highlights why you’re excited about their company.

    What Are Disruptive Cover Letters?

    Disruptive cover letters are a game-changing strategy designed to help you stand out. Unlike traditional cover letters, they don’t look like cover letters at all. They focus on storytelling and creating an emotional connection with the employer.

    Here’s how they work:

    1. Start with a bold, personal statement: For example, one of my clients who applied to Google wrote: “I remember the first time I used Google search, and it changed my life…” This immediately grabs attention and sets the stage for a compelling story.
    2. Tell your connection story: Explain why you feel aligned with the company’s mission, values, or brand. For example, another client who applied to a major snack brand shared: “Six Oreos and a glass of milk was my go-to snack after every soccer game…” The result? An interview.
    3. Explain your value through storytelling: Instead of listing qualifications, weave them into a narrative that demonstrates how you’re the right fit for the role.
    4. End with a call to action: Ask for the opportunity to discuss how you can contribute to their success.

    Humans are wired for stories. Social media and viral content prove that stories evoke emotions, make ideas memorable, and create connections. In a competitive job market, storytelling is the surest way to set yourself apart from other candidates and stand out to employers by fostering an emotional bond with the hiring team.

    Taking It to the Next Level

    If you want to go above and beyond, consider turning your disruptive cover letter into a video. A video cover letter allows you to share your connection story in a personal, dynamic way. Imagine starting your video with:

    “Let me tell you the story of how I discovered your company and why I’m passionate about joining your team…”

    These video introductions get candidates noticed and land them interviews.
